These sliced apples topped with cream cheese and spices are a subtle nod to Princess Leia and her iconic hair style. These apple treats will help keep your energy up as you lead the rebellion.

Ingredients:

  • 1 apple
  • ½ cup whipped cream cheese
  • 1 Tablespoon cocoa powder
  • 2 teaspoons powdered sugar
  • ¼ teaspoon cinnamon

Directions:

Step 1: In a bowl, stir together the cream cheese, cocoa powder, powdered sugar, and cinnamon. Set aside.

Step 2: Slice the apple into rounds.

Step 3: Pipe the cocoa cream cheese mixture onto the apple slices to create Leia’s hairstyle.
